Transaction 95d0084317646e794ee594398b1be4bff8fecbe990aa6d270ef22227f7ccb15f

2 Input
2 Outputs
  • 95d0084317646e794ee594398b1be4bff8fecbe990aa6d270ef22227f7ccb15f:0
  • value  21000000
    address  3NamY4hTW65EwvZ7XavCbKARWFPS1G32Kv
  • 95d0084317646e794ee594398b1be4bff8fecbe990aa6d270ef22227f7ccb15f:1
  • value  71565742
    address  3EThgaPo8MeyuLkKEapcDKQvSy2DJX8rpm